directory.republicofgreen.com - Republic of Green

Huffman Solar

1896 Creek Dr
San Jose, CA 95125 USA

408-406-3591

SEND MESSAGE
No Reviews | Write a Review
Green HOME & GARDEN, Solar Installation & Maintenance
Claim Listing - Huffman Solar Are you Huffman Solar? Claim this listing to receive referrals from this page. Claim Listing

CONTACT INFORMATION

  • Company
  • Huffman Solar
  • Location
  • 1896 Creek Dr
    San Jose, CA 95125
    United States
  • Principal(s)
  • Bill Huffman, Founder & Owner

COMPANY DETAILS


Business Overview & Services
Our energy is focused on solar designs, and identification of optimal equipment and installation methodology… With emphasis on the customer and his/her home or business.
View On Larger Map »

FIND